About This RoleNow is one of the most exciting moments in the history of the Green Party. With record-breaking membership growth, rising public support with record polling growth, and on the back of record-breaking local elections and our historic win in Gorton and Denton, our media team is expanding to meet the scale of this moment. We’re looking for a driven, politically savvy Assistant Press Officer who thrives in a fast-paced environment and is ready to work flexibly as part of a small, dynamic team shaping the national conversation.
To support the delivery of effective and timely media communications that strengthen the profile of the Green Party and its elected representatives, the Assistant Press Officer will assist with media monitoring, press office administration, drafting communications materials and supporting media activity across the Party.
A knowledge of social media is an advantage, but note this is to work in the press team, not the social media team. If you have sharp political instincts, excellent writing skills, and a passion for climate and social justice and democracy, we’d love to hear from you.
Media MonitoringMonitor news coverage and political developments, and compile media summaries and daily news briefings.
Drafting & ContentDraft press releases, quotes, Q&As and lines to take under the supervision of senior colleagues.
Campaigns & EventsSupport media activity around campaigns, launches, visits, conferences and major Party events.
Press Office SupportMaintain media contact databases and press office systems, and support spokespeople at appearances.
The role is flexible, ideally London based and able to work from our Lambeth office with some home working. It reports to the Press Manager and works closely with the Communications Team. Some experience in communications, media, journalism, politics or campaigning is essential, and may have been gained through paid work, internships, volunteering or student media.
